Is the female gaze real?

The female gaze is a feminist film theoretical term representing the gaze of the female viewer. It is a response to feminist film theorist Laura Mulvey’s term “the male gaze”, which represents not only the gaze of a heterosexual male viewer but also the gaze of the male character and the male creator of the film.

What is a Disconjugate gaze?

Definition. Dysconjugate gaze is a failure of the eyes to turn together in the same direction.

What is gaze preference?

Definition. An abnormality of gaze that can be observed following an acute supranuclear cerebral lesion (e.g., stroke) that is characterized by an acute inability to direct gaze contralateral to the side of the lesion and is accompanied by a tendency for tonic deviation of the eyes toward the side of the lesion. Why do eyes deviate in stroke?

In the case of a right-sided stroke in a patient with a left-dominant brain, signals from the right brain to the left eye are disrupted, whereas signals from the left brain to the right eye continue to work (Fig. 2 and Fig. 3). The result is conjugate eye deviation to the right (and temporary gaze palsy to the left).

What causes Disconjugate gaze?

The most well-recognized syndrome is INO, wherein slowing of the adducting eye is caused by inability of the MLF to conduct high-frequency signals. However, disease affecting the ocular motor nerves, the neuromuscular junction, or the extraocular muscles could also cause saccades to become disconjugate.

How do you test gaze palsy?

How do I examine for a supranuclear gaze palsy (SNGP)? Assessment is best undertaken in a hierarchical way; initially assess saccades to command, then saccades to targets, then smooth pursuit of a target, and finally with the vestibul‐ocular reflex (VOR).

Why is convergence preserved in internuclear ophthalmoplegia?

If a lesion in the MLF blocks signals from the horizontal gaze center to the 3rd cranial nerve, the eye on the affected side cannot adduct (or adducts weakly) past the midline. The affected eye adducts normally in convergence because convergence does not require signals from the horizontal gaze center.

What is one and a half syndrome?

One-and-a-half syndrome is a gaze abnormality characterized by a conjugate horizontal gaze palsy in one direction plus an internuclear ophthalmoplegia in the other. One-and-a-half syndrome is most often caused by multiple sclerosis (MS), brain stem stroke, brain stem tumors, and arteriovenous malformations.
